Publisher Description: The digital copies of this book are available for free at First Fruits website. place.asburyseminary.edu/firstfruits Who cares about the soul anymore? Contrary to some voices in our secular society, apparently, quite a few people. A recent Newsweek Poll reported that 58 percent of Americans say they feel the need to experience spiritual growth. There is a remarkably widespread hunger for meaning spanning our society. And there is an equally widespread menu of spiritual offerings from which to choose. In the midst of these, one wonders just what is authentic spirituality? In Soul Care, Kenneth J. Collins carefully answers this question and gives clear direction by showing us: Our souls need to be nurtured, no matter where we are in our spiritual journey-uncertain seeker or seasoned saint.
